Solution for 3(x-4)=40 equation:


Simplifying
3(x + -4) = 40

Reorder the terms:
3(-4 + x) = 40
(-4 * 3 + x * 3) = 40
(-12 + 3x) = 40

Solving
-12 + 3x = 40

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'12' to each side of the equation.
-12 + 12 + 3x = 40 + 12

Combine like terms: -12 + 12 = 0
0 + 3x = 40 + 12
3x = 40 + 12

Combine like terms: 40 + 12 = 52
3x = 52

Divide each side by '3'.
x = 17.33333333

Simplifying
x = 17.33333333
